Question, did you paint the brown parts with the white lettering, or did you buy black replacement pieces? Like the radio "VOL POWER" Label for example. Thanks

Very good question. I actually painted over the seat buttons ones. He had already installed the black volume **** and temperature and hazard button. I just changed the back lighting to LEDS.
